对象存储 开源软件,深入解析对象存储开源软件,功能、优势与应用场景
- 综合资讯
- 2024-11-19 19:44:52
- 2

深入解析对象存储开源软件,本文详细介绍了其功能、优势与应用场景。对象存储作为一种新兴的存储技术,具有高扩展性、高可靠性等特点,广泛应用于云存储、大数据等领域。本文将为您...
深入解析对象存储开源软件,本文详细介绍了其功能、优势与应用场景。对象存储作为一种新兴的存储技术,具有高扩展性、高可靠性等特点,广泛应用于云存储、大数据等领域。本文将为您揭示对象存储开源软件的魅力。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的文件存储方式已无法满足需求,对象存储作为一种新兴的存储技术,以其分布式、可扩展、高可靠等特点,逐渐成为大数据、云计算等领域的首选存储方式,本文将深入解析对象存储开源软件,探讨其功能、优势以及应用场景。
对象存储开源软件概述
1、什么是对象存储
对象存储是一种基于文件的存储方式,将数据存储为对象,每个对象包含数据、元数据和存储路径,与传统的文件存储相比,对象存储具有更高的可扩展性、灵活性和可靠性。
2、对象存储开源软件的定义
对象存储开源软件是指遵循开源协议,可供用户免费使用、修改和共享的软件,常见的对象存储开源软件有OpenStack Swift、Ceph、GlusterFS等。
对象存储开源软件功能
1、存储管理
(1)存储空间管理:包括存储池的创建、删除、扩展和收缩。
(2)存储节点管理:包括存储节点的添加、删除、状态监控等。
(3)存储容量监控:实时监控存储空间的利用率,预警存储空间不足。
2、数据管理
(1)数据上传:支持多种数据上传方式,如HTTP、HTTPS、FTP等。
(2)数据下载:支持多种数据下载方式,如HTTP、HTTPS、FTP等。
(3)数据复制:支持数据在不同存储节点之间的复制,保证数据可靠性。
(4)数据备份:支持数据备份和恢复功能,防止数据丢失。
3、访问控制
(1)用户认证:支持多种认证方式,如基本认证、摘要认证等。
(2)权限控制:支持对存储空间、存储节点、数据等对象的访问权限控制。
(3)审计日志:记录用户访问日志,便于安全审计。
对象存储开源软件优势
1、开源:用户可免费使用、修改和共享软件,降低成本。
2、可扩展性:支持海量数据的存储,可满足大规模应用需求。
3、高可靠性:采用分布式存储架构,数据冗余存储,保证数据安全性。
4、灵活性:支持多种数据访问协议,满足不同应用场景需求。
5、易于集成:与其他开源软件(如OpenStack、Ceph等)具有良好的兼容性。
对象存储开源软件应用场景
1、云计算平台:对象存储是云计算平台的重要组成部分,可提供海量数据的存储服务。
2、大数据应用:对象存储可满足大数据应用对海量数据的存储需求。
3、文件共享服务:对象存储支持海量文件的存储和共享,适用于企业内部或个人用户。
4、数字资产管理:对象存储可存储和管理大量数字资产,如图片、视频等。
5、分布式存储系统:对象存储可构建分布式存储系统,提高数据存储效率。
对象存储开源软件作为一种新兴的存储技术,具有广泛的应用前景,本文从功能、优势、应用场景等方面对对象存储开源软件进行了深入解析,旨在为用户提供更全面、客观的了解,随着技术的不断发展,对象存储开源软件将在更多领域发挥重要作用。
本文链接:https://www.zhitaoyun.cn/954591.html
发表评论